Address: 13 Devonshire St, CA11 7SR, Penrith
Phone: +44 1768 891417
Work time: Tuesday:9:30am-4:30pm
Wednesday:9:30am-4:30pm
Thursday:9:30am-4:30pm
Friday:9:30am-4:30pm
Saturday:9:30am-4:30pm
Sunday:Closed
Monday:9:30am-4:30pm

About The Narrowbar Cafe

The Narrowbar Cafe, is located at 13 Devonshire St, Penrith, CA11 7SR, UK

How to get to The Narrowbar Cafe?